Common Damage Restoration Issues in Mississippi County, Arkansas
The county sits on the western bank of the Mississippi River in flat alluvial farmland, and that geography shapes nearly every loss we respond to. High water tables, poor surface drainage, and ditch systems that back up during heavy rain push water into low-lying structures far more often than in hillier parts of Arkansas.
Frequent Causes of Damage
- Spring river rise and backwater flooding along the levee districts near Luxora, Wilson, and Osceola
- Saturated ground and hydrostatic pressure forcing water through slab cracks and cellar walls
- Sewer main surcharges during intense rainfall, sending wastewater back through floor drains and tubs
- Aging cast iron and galvanized plumbing in mid-century homes failing at joints
- Frozen and burst pipes during hard January and February cold snaps
- Tornadoes and straight-line winds tearing roof decking loose, followed by rain intrusion
- Space heater, wood stove, and grease fires during the cold months
- Lightning strikes on rural properties with limited fire department response distance
Warning Signs Worth Acting On
- Musty odor in a crawl space, closet, or laundry area that returns after cleaning
- Cupping hardwood, bubbling vinyl plank, or soft spots underfoot
- Tide lines or chalky mineral staining on basement and cellar walls
- Slow floor drains, gurgling toilets, or backing up when the washer discharges
- Soot filming on window glass, light fixtures, or the tops of door casings
- Persistent smoke odor that intensifies with humidity or when the HVAC runs

Seasonal Damage Patterns in Mississippi County
- January - February: Burst pipes in unheated crawl spaces, attic supply lines, and vacant farm structures. Heating equipment and space heater fires peak. Ice accumulation on aging rooflines creates meltwater intrusion.
- March - May: The heaviest season for flooded basements and cellars. River rise, backwater from drainage ditches, and severe thunderstorm systems drive both groundwater intrusion and sewer backups. Tornado season brings roof loss followed by rain damage.
- June - August: Delta humidity keeps indoor dew points high. Mold growth accelerates in crawl spaces, closets, and any structure that dried incompletely in spring. Air conditioning condensate line clogs cause ceiling and wall damage.
- September - October: Field burning and agricultural dust affect indoor air quality. Lingering warmth keeps mold active while homeowners close up houses.
- November - December: Fireplace and wood stove startup produces chimney and flue fires. Holiday cooking fires generate widespread smoke and soot deposits.
Housing Characteristics & Restoration Considerations
Housing across Mississippi County skews older than the state average. Much of Blytheville and Osceola was built between the 1920s and the 1960s, with a second wave of construction tied to the air base era. Manila, Leachville, and Gosnell mix that older stock with ranch homes and manufactured housing on rural lots.
Construction Features That Shape Restoration Work
- Pier-and-beam foundations with vented crawl spaces - common in pre-1970 homes and a primary mold reservoir in humid months
- Slab-on-grade ranch construction - traps water under flooring where it wicks into bottom plates and baseboards
- Cellars and partial basements - relatively rare in the Delta but highly flood-prone where they exist
- Plaster over wood lath - holds moisture and smoke residue differently than drywall and requires slower, gentler drying
- Original hardwood over board subfloor - salvageable with fast response, unsalvageable once cupping sets and the subfloor delaminates
- Cast iron drain stacks - corrode and crack, leading to hidden sewage leaks under floors
- Manufactured homes - belly wrap traps water beneath the floor and needs opening and drying, not surface treatment only
Older properties also carry a realistic likelihood of asbestos-containing floor tile, mastic, and pipe insulation, plus lead paint on trim. We test before demolition rather than after, so that fire, water, and mold work proceeds without spreading regulated materials through the rest of the house.
Environmental Conditions & Damage Implications
Mississippi County sits on deep Mississippi River alluvial deposits - silt loam and clay soils that drain slowly and hold water against foundations. The land is exceptionally flat, so runoff depends on ditches and pump stations rather than natural grade.
Local Conditions and What They Mean
- High water table: Crawl spaces stay damp for extended periods, so mold remediation must include vapor barriers and drainage correction, not just cleaning
- Clay-rich soil: Expands and contracts seasonally, opening slab cracks and foundation gaps that admit water
- Humid subtropical climate: Summer dew points regularly support mold colonization within days of a water event
- Agricultural surroundings: Floodwater and backwater can carry fertilizer, herbicide, and livestock runoff, elevating contamination categories
- Seasonal field burning and dust: Adds particulate load that complicates post-fire air quality restoration and HVAC cleaning
- Mineral-heavy well and municipal water: Leaves staining on materials after water losses that requires specific cleaning agents
- New Madrid seismic zone: Minor structural shifting over decades widens gaps in foundations and around penetrations
These factors influence how we set drying targets. A structure dried to a coastal or upland standard may still hold enough moisture in Delta conditions to support regrowth, so we measure against local baseline readings taken from unaffected areas of the same building.
Working With Insurance and Flood Coverage in the Arkansas Delta
Many Mississippi County property owners discover the difference between water damage and flood damage at the worst possible moment. Standard homeowners policies generally respond to sudden internal water releases - a burst pipe, a failed water heater, an appliance supply line - while rising surface water from the river, a ditch, or saturated ground typically falls under separate flood coverage. Sewage backup often requires its own endorsement.

Questions Worth Asking Your Agent Now
- Do I carry a separate flood policy, and does it cover contents as well as structure?
- Is water and sewer backup coverage included on my policy?
- Does my coverage address mold remediation when it results from a covered loss?
- What documentation does my carrier expect after fire or smoke damage?
- Are detached shops, barns, and outbuildings on the same policy?
